Lester joined the Miami franchise on December 20 of last year. But his history with the NFL teams started back in 2019, were he joined the Oakland Raiders. But since he arrived, everything went downhill for Lester, he joined the Oakland Raiders, and during his time on the team, he went in and out of the practice squad. 

But an opportunity appeared for Cotton, the Oakland Riders moved the franchise to Las Vegas. And in February 2021, Las Vegas signed the former Alabama player, but the same thing occurs to him. Until December 2022, the Miami Dolphins signed him to the practice squad. And in January he was elevated to the active roster.
